Auteur Sujet: Le guide complet : Internet, TV et Téléphone sans Livebox (et bien plus encore)  (Lu 218472 fois)

0 Membres et 2 Invités sur ce sujet

Labure

  • Abonné Orange Fibre
  • *
  • Messages: 30
  • Béziers 34
Bonjours a tous

Orange m'installera la fibre le 13 avril prochain

Ma config pour l'instant est une freebox v5 en adsl en mode bridge, mon routeur est un pc sous debian 8, deux cartes reseau une pour la freebox est une autre pour le lan. deux switch manageable dlink.

Je vais rajouter une carte reseau pour la fibre  car je garde la freebox en connexion de secours.

Qui peut me donner des lien sur des tutos recent en linux debian ou ubuntu ? (j'ai lu deja pas mal mais c souvent avec le mode ppoe)

 Car je peux convertir les config de seb mais ca va etre long. surtout pour la tv.
Le but c'est de virer la livebox et de garder que le boitier télé et de connecter le sip a mon serveur asterix.

Merci et bravo a tous pour ce travail de reverse ;-)

petrus

  • Expert AS206155
  • Expert
  • *
  • Messages: 1 064
https://lafibre.info/remplacer-livebox/remplacer-la-livebox-sans-pppoe/

Il est trop visible le topic parce qu'il est épinglé ?


Labure

  • Abonné Orange Fibre
  • *
  • Messages: 30
  • Béziers 34
J'ai lu ce topic et pour le dhcp pas de soucis, c'est pour la télé que j'aimerais trouver un tuto sur linux debian ou unbuntu ;-)

pci

  • Abonné Orange Fibre
  • *
  • Messages: 60
  • FFTH 200/100 Antibes (06)
Salut Tous,
alors voilà je bloque un peu sur la partie TV. Le décodeur me dit "Chaîne indisponible", mais je vois le programme TV.
Je penche pour un pb routing multicast.
Concernant mon environnement, j'ai un boitier linux avec 3 interfaces réseau filaire
eth0->ONT
em1->LAN
eth1->decodeur TV

J'ai fait un petit bridge "br1":
bridge name bridge id STP enabled interfaces
br1 8000.0023563c9234 no eth1
vlan838
vlan840


Ma conf igmpproxy:
##------------------------------------------------------
## Enable Quickleave mode (Sends Leave instantly)
##------------------------------------------------------
quickleave

##------------------------------------------------------
## Configuration for eth0 (Upstream Interface)
##------------------------------------------------------
phyint vlan840 upstream ratelimit 0 threshold 1
   altnet 0.0.0.0/0

##------------------------------------------------------
## Configuration for eth1 (Downstream Interface)
##------------------------------------------------------
phyint eth1 downstream ratelimit 0 threshold 1
   altnet 0.0.0.0/0

##------------------------------------------------------
## Configuration for Nic (Disabled Interface)
##------------------------------------------------------
phyint wlan0 disabled
phyint wlan1 disabled
phyint eth0 disabled
phyint lo disabled
phyint docker0 disabled
phyint vlan838 disabled

Les traces imgpproxy:
buildIfVc: Interface br1 Addr: 192.168.3.1, Flags: 0x1043, Network: 192.168.3/24
Found config for wlan0
Found config for wlan1
Found config for docker0
Found config for vlan838
Found config for vlan840
adding VIF, Ix 0 Fl 0x0 IP 0xfeffa8c0 vlan840, Threshold: 1, Ratelimit: 0
        Network for [vlan840] : 192.168.255/24
        Network for [vlan840] : default
Got 262144 byte buffer size in 0 iterations
Created timeout 1 (#0) - delay 10 secs
(Id:1, Time:10)
Created timeout 2 (#1) - delay 21 secs
(Id:1, Time:10)
(Id:2, Time:21)
RECV Membership query   from 0.0.0.0         to 224.0.0.1
About to call timeout 1 (#0)
Aging routes in table.

Current routing table (Age active routes):
-----------------------------------------------------
No routes in table...
-----------------------------------------------------
About to call timeout 2 (#0)
Created timeout 3 (#0) - delay 10 secs
(Id:3, Time:10)
Created timeout 4 (#1) - delay 21 secs
(Id:3, Time:10)
(Id:4, Time:21)
About to call timeout 3 (#0)
Aging routes in table.

Current routing table (Age active routes):
-----------------------------------------------------
No routes in table...
-----------------------------------------------------

Les prios des vlan:
vlan838
vlan838  VID: 838 REORDER_HDR: 1  dev->priv_flags: 1201
         total frames received            2
          total bytes received          972
      Broadcast/Multicast Rcvd            0

      total frames transmitted          161
       total bytes transmitted        41096
Device: eth0
INGRESS priority mappings: 0:0  1:0  2:0  3:0  4:0  5:0  6:0 7:0
 EGRESS priority mappings: 0:4 1:4 2:4 3:4 4:4 5:4 6:6 7:4

le vlan840
vlan840  VID: 840 REORDER_HDR: 1  dev->priv_flags: 1201
         total frames received           16
          total bytes received          736
      Broadcast/Multicast Rcvd           16

      total frames transmitted          147
       total bytes transmitted        40463
Device: eth0
INGRESS priority mappings: 0:0  1:0  2:0  3:0  4:0  5:0  6:0 7:0
 EGRESS priority mappings: 0:5 1:5 2:5 3:5 4:5 5:5 6:6 7:5

Et ce qui sort de mon décodeur sans jamais recevoir le moindre retour:
=>tcpdump -nni vlan840
22:13:36.963626 IP 192.168.3.20.51013 > 239.255.255.250.1900: UDP, length 340
22:13:37.083556 IP 192.168.3.20.51013 > 239.255.255.250.1900: UDP, length 322
22:13:37.123674 IP 192.168.3.20.51013 > 239.255.255.250.1900: UDP, length 330
22:13:37.359649 IP 192.168.3.20.51013 > 239.255.255.250.1900: UDP, length 332
22:13:37.416273 IP 192.168.3.20.51013 > 239.255.255.250.1900: UDP, length 285
22:13:52.312688 IP 0.0.0.0 > 224.0.0.1: igmp query v2
22:13:57.630968 IP 192.168.3.20 > 239.255.255.250: igmp v2 report 239.255.255.250
22:14:31.687897 IP 192.168.3.20.51011 > 239.255.255.250.1900: UDP, length 137
22:14:31.956606 IP 0.0.0.0 > 224.0.0.1: igmp query v2
22:14:40.798241 IP 192.168.3.20 > 239.255.255.250: igmp v2 report 239.255.255.250
22:15:11.560628 IP 0.0.0.0 > 224.0.0.1: igmp query v2
22:15:18.493351 IP 192.168.3.20 > 239.255.255.250: igmp v2 report 239.255.255.250

Si quelqu'un a une idée elle sera super bien venu :-)
Merci

ps: j'ai oublié de préciser que mon firewall est en ACCEPT ALL ;)













kgersen

  • Modérateur
  • Abonné Bbox fibre
  • *
  • Messages: 9 078
  • Paris (75)
c'est direct en eth1 et le décodeur TV ou y'a un switch entre ?

la config firewall (iptables) ne bloque pas les flux TV?

pci

  • Abonné Orange Fibre
  • *
  • Messages: 60
  • FFTH 200/100 Antibes (06)
Salut kgersen,
c'est en direct, ton message m'a fait réfléchir au côté "direct" et en relisant le doc de seb59 j'ai vu qu'il me manquait un masquerading vers le 840 et le 838.

J'ai la télé :)

Je mettrais tout ça à l'ombre du ba0bab ;-)

Merci (et à tous pour vos contributions)

Labure

  • Abonné Orange Fibre
  • *
  • Messages: 30
  • Béziers 34
pas sure qu'un masquerade sur le 840 soit nécessaire, a voir .

kgersen

  • Modérateur
  • Abonné Bbox fibre
  • *
  • Messages: 9 078
  • Paris (75)
pas sure qu'un masquerade sur le 840 soit nécessaire, a voir .

non mais faut que la requête igmp remonte avec une IP par la quand meme. En général il suffit de mettre une IP quelconque sur le port wan 840. Pour le 838 il faut un masquerade.

par contre je vois un erreur dans le conf pour vlan840 (sur: https://github.com/pci06/ba0bab/blob/master/original/etc/network/interfaces.d/orange )

up /bin/ip link set dev vlan838 ...

ca ne met pas les bonnes CoS pour 840.


pci

  • Abonné Orange Fibre
  • *
  • Messages: 60
  • FFTH 200/100 Antibes (06)
Salut,
je l'ai vu hier soir la cougnette du vlan838 :)
je l'ai corrigé mais pas encore pushé.
Je mettrais aussi la conf iptables "orange"

Pour le masquerade du 840 je vais refaire un test car ça me trouble un peu (il porte bien une ip la fameuse 192.168.255.254/24 des tutos)

En ce moment y'a que le replay qui veut pas.

++

zoc

  • Abonné Orange Fibre
  • *
  • Messages: 4 258
  • Antibes (06) / Mercury (73)
Accessoirement, si tu
  • Assigne une IP quelconque à eth0.840
  • Obtiens une IP par DHCP sur eth0.838

Alors tu n'as pas besoin de bridger les 2 VLAN et le NAT n'est nécessaire que sur le VLAN 838.

Pour le replay, il faut utiliser l'option DHCP 120 sur le VLAN 838 pour obtenir les routes, et s'assurer que la table de routage est bien modifiée en conséquence

Édit: et aussi s'assurer que le décodeur utilisé bien les DNS d'Orange...


pci

  • Abonné Orange Fibre
  • *
  • Messages: 60
  • FFTH 200/100 Antibes (06)
Salut,
Accessoirement, si tu
  • Assigne une IP quelconque à eth0.840
  • Obtiens une IP par DHCP sur eth0.838

ça j'ai

Alors tu n'as pas besoin de bridger les 2 VLAN et le NAT n'est nécessaire que sur le VLAN 838.

Pour le replay, il faut utiliser l'option DHCP 120 sur le VLAN 838 pour obtenir les routes, et s'assurer que la table de routage est bien modifiée en conséquence
et ça c'est bon à savoir :)

Merci :)

zoc

  • Abonné Orange Fibre
  • *
  • Messages: 4 258
  • Antibes (06) / Mercury (73)
 Je me suis planté, c'est l'option 90 pour les routes (classless static routes), pas 120 (120 c'est SIP  ::) ).